Output c59c61e4a8abc8a5e462a42cf9d690def56f6aff1d7d9ccc201280ee835d91fe:0

value
28340
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84f504a83c3f74bbb81e5a609ebe54c7098971031ab6686994f72598e926452a
address
bc1psn6sf2pu8a6thwq7tfsfa0j5cuycjugrr2mxs6v57uje36fxg54qpml5u4
transaction
c59c61e4a8abc8a5e462a42cf9d690def56f6aff1d7d9ccc201280ee835d91fe
confirmations
104747
spent
true